Srinagar, Dec 15:  Cyber Crime Police in Srinagar city arrested a youth for hacking the Facebook page of Doctors Association Kashmir.

    The facebook page having lakhs of hits was run of Doctors Association Kashmir (DAK) headed by Dr Nisar-ul-Hasan.

   Confirming the arrest of the youth, a police official from Nigeen Police Station identified the accused as Naveed Ahmed Shah, a medical representative working for a drug company ‘Alif Remedies’.

  “We used this facebook to sensitize common people about the use and spread of spurious drugs. We believed that facebook page was deleted by accused on the instructions of those who deal in spurious drugs in Kashmir Valley,” said Dr Nisar-ul-Hasan told news agency CNS.

 He added that on the launch of their website the accused introduced himself as an IT expert and sought username and password of their facebook page.

  “On November 18 last month, the two admins of this fb page, Dr Reyaz Ahmed Dagga and Shafiq Khambay received notifications that they have been removed as admins from the page. Accordingly we lodged a complaint before police station Nigeen and we are grateful to them for solving the case,” Dr Nisar-ul-Hassan said. (CNS)
